How it feels

This is a movie about a bunch of oddball characters hanging out in Austin, Texas over the course of one day. The action passes from one person to another as the camera follows whoever catches its attention.

What happens

Slacker is a 1990 American comedy drama film written, produced, and directed by Richard Linklater, who also stars in it. Filmed around Austin, Texas, the film follows an ensemble cast of eccentric and misfit locals throughout a single day. Each character is on screen for only a few minutes before the film picks up someone else in the scene and follows them. Slacker premiered at the USA Film Festival on April 21, 1990, and was released in the United States on July 5, 1991, by Orion Classics. The film received positive reviews from critics and grossed over $1 million against a production budget of $23,000. In 2012, Slacker was selected for preservation in the United States National Film Registry by the Library of Congress as being "culturally, historically, or aesthetically significant".
